Assessment of Dynamic Pile Driving Using Machine Learning. This project aims at developing new technology to determine ground properties and foundation capacity in real-time during pile installation by adopting rigorous numerical simulation, laboratory experiments and artificial intelligence-based computational model. Although impact driving is used commonly to install piles on site, there is no technology currently available to interpret collected data accurately and in real-time to provide live feedback and optimise construction processes. This research will provide new machine learning model to assess the ground and foundation characteristics during construction, and will increase certainty in infrastructure investment in Australia particularly for costly transport assets and infrastructure.
